塚 is the kanji for "Mound". Its reading is つか (tsuka). This page includes example sentences and a stroke-order diagram.
Meaning
Mound
Also : Hillock · Tomb

Readings
kunつか/ tsukakunづか/ zukaonちょう/ chou
kun = Japanese reading · on = Chinese reading

Example Sentences
古い塚を発見した。
ふるいつかをはっけんした。
An old mound was discovered.
塚の周りを歩く。
つかのまわりをあるく。
Walk around the mound.
